Netwerken zijn nodig in elk deel van het IT-gebied en het vereist een constante behoefte en ontwikkeling. Met deze constante behoefte aan netwerken, is netwerkbeveiliging ook nodig en moet er een behoefte zijn om de gegevens te controleren die op het netwerk worden gedeeld. Ons project werkt op de client-server architectuur. Het bewaakt niet alleen de gegevens, maar helpt ook bij het delen van de bestanden wanneer deze op een gemeenschappelijk netwerk zijn aangesloten en houdt het netwerkverkeer in stand zodat iedere geautoriseerde persoon zonder vertraging of probleem toegang heeft tot de bestanden. Het delen gebeurt met Symmetrische encryptie die de Advance Encryption Standards (AES) gebruikt. Een persoon moet zich eerst registreren. Deze informatie wordt gedeeld met de admin die de registratie kan toestaan of blokkeren. Zodra de persoon is geregistreerd, kan hij/zij gegevens of bestanden verzenden naar alleen de geregistreerde gebruikers. De gebruiker moet het bestand registreren met een versleutelde sleutel en de ontvanger moet het ontsleutelen met dezelfde sleutel. Dit hele proces wordt gecontroleerd door de admin en als iemand probeert in te breken in het systeem zal er een melding verschijnen en kan de admin het IP-adres traceren en die specifieke persoon blokkeren. De communicatie is volledig draadloos en intern.